Our four children proposed and that was the beginning of a new family of six.
The day was filled with electricity as we ascended the steps and entered the sanctuary of the beautiful, old stone church. Our lives were about to embark on an adventure that would change each of us forever. We entered those walls as individual lives and emerged, a family held in God's hands.
This man had been my friend for half my life but I knew, as his wife, our relationship would begin anew. We were taking a tremendous chance on our faith in God, in one another, and our faith in the ability of our four children to cope with, and grow within, our mutual decision.
The six of us vowed that day to work and plan for the future together. Each child, all four having spoken vows within the wedding ceremony, took their part in the decision to become a family very seriously.
